About this opportunity
The Wadsworth International Fellowship provides funding for students pursuing a PhD or equivalent doctoral degree at universities where they can receive international-level training in anthropology. This program is only available to students from countries where anthropology is underrepresented and where there are limited resources to educate students overseas. The program's goal is to extend and strengthen international ties and deepen anthropological expertise globally. Priority is given to applicants who have not yet begun graduate training abroad (or are in the early stages of their program) and who are likely to return to an academic position in their home country upon completion of their degree.
The $20,000 annual fellowship can be used toward travel, living expenses, tuition, income taxes, student fees, insurance, books, research costs, and any other relevant expenditures incurred in the course of the doctoral program. Fellows may renew the award for up to two additional years upon successful completion of each preceding year of training, for a total of three years of support. Fellows can also apply separately for an additional year of support for dissertation write-up.
The Foundation is looking for talented scholars who might not otherwise be able to pursue a doctoral degree, with the potential to advance anthropology in their home countries and globally. Successful applicants provide strong evidence of academic excellence in their prior training in anthropology or a related discipline, have well-developed training and research goals, and can demonstrate that both their host institution and host sponsor are good fits to help them reach those goals.
